Omni Plant
Game The Sims 3
Buyable Opportunity
Price N/A
Type Special, Garden plant
Size 1x1 floor[TS3]

The Omni Plant is a special plant in The Sims 3 that can be used to replicate many other plants, as well as other objects -- including some books and fish. The plant can only be planted by Sims that have a gardening skill level of 10. Some special plants, such as death flowers cannot be replicated using the Omni Plant. The Omni Plant cannot die.

The Omni Plant is obtained by completing the Uncommonly Good, Outstandingly Rare, and The Omnificient Plant opportunities. It may also be found at the Landgraab Industries Science Facility, while fishing, or received as a random reward after going into the past in the time machine.

The Omni Plant is excellent for getting rare fruit and fish, because it can be fed with anything from life fruit to robot fish and deathfish. The Omni Plant can also be fed with books or teddy bears.

Once you have received the Omni Plant for the first time after completing the opportunity, you can order more seeds through the mail. Some players have found a glitch where ordering Omni Plant seeds has been impossible.

(There is no confirmed fix for this yet, but a temporary workaround may be utilized as follows: select the order option, allow your sim to begin walking to his/her mailbox, then before your sim ever reaches the mailbox, cancel the action. The bill paying animation will activate, and the option will be greyed out, stating that the seed shipment is on its way. It seems that allowing your sim to reach the mailbox cancels the animation and the operation altogether. This solution works as of v1.24.) [needs confirmation from other testers]
